Fine Motor
Funded Dec 31, 2022Thank you so much for funding all the fine motor activities on my Donor's Choose project for some hands on activities for my students. They use these activities daily in their stations.
Each morning, they rotate between stations and we have used some of the things from the project for our fine motor and word work stations. The students love being able to see new things in the fine motor station each week and love getting to work with the new materials. They LOVE the sight word Pop-it game as well!
Thank you again for helping our class to build our fine motor skills, and for allowing us fun, colorful ways to do it. I appreciate your continued support!”

Learning Through Play
Funded Aug 8, 2022Thank you again, so, so much for all of your support by providing so many wonderful things for our classroom. The students were so excited to see all the materials come in and have really enjoyed using them this semester.
We are using most of it throughout our daily station time, such as at the sensory table to work on fine motor, or during Fun Friday where we have free choice to play and explore with things like the Kinetic Sand and Legos. Some of the materials have been used as positive rewards/incentives for the students, such as the certificates given when goals are met. Mostly we are using a lot of the items for fine motor practice, the sensory table for phonics review, and at our word work station.
Again, thank you so much for all of your support. We appreciate your generosity and kindness!”

Making Kindergarten Fun!
Funded Aug 22, 2021Thank you so much for your donation earlier this year for all our engaging activities. We've used some of them in our calm down corner, for Fun Friday, during our whole group handwriting lessons, and during station time. The students really loved the large magnetic letters during handwriting the first semester of school. It really helped them see how to form their letters correctly. The students are also currently so excited about using the pegboards in Math stations to create shapes.
Thank you again for all your support and for bringing some extra excitement into our classroom with your donations. I am so thankful!”
